Position at corners or edges of activity areas for maximum visibility of all students and clear communication
Watch for communication attempts, positioning discipline, and coordinated movement patterns throughout activities
Step in if students struggle with zone boundaries, communication breaks down, or team shape deteriorates significantly
Use clear, exaggerated movements when showing positioning concepts, ensure all students can see demonstrations clearly
Minimum 30m x 40m area, clear of obstacles and hazards
Even, dry surface suitable for running and quick direction changes
Clear stop signal established, first aid kit accessible, emergency contact procedures known
